I would like to know what peoples opinions are on how much shaft play is normal for a turbo to have? Mine is about 1-1.5 mm total. It just feels like a lot more than what it should have. I have a SS2 with 0.82 rear. The car is also driven hard all the time. But does get good warm ups and cool downs

There should be around 30thou clearance which is just under a mm, you can't get 1.5mm as it would be scrapping housings. pressurized oil centers the shaft once engine starts, so as long as its running and boosting then its all normal.

Finally had the .70 SS2 Tune on the high mount with plumb back external gate. The SS2 maxed out touch under 360rwkws (359.3rwkws) on 22psi of boost. 30kws gain over the side mount internal gate setup.

atr43ss2exgpower.jpg

Boost:

atr43ss2exgboost.jpg

This turbo probably had the most area under curve in its HP range, felt excellent on road.

    • The ABS and/or TCS being missing/broken will not cause the engine to misbehave. It just casues CEL to come on and annoy you. The CEL is useless if it is always on, so you have to do the things you have to do to get rid of it, so it can be useful. Being a Stag ECU, then yes, it will not expect TCS to be present. But it will expect ABS to be present and working. You will need to either make the ABS CU talk to the ECU (don't ask me what that will take on an NA R34), and make sure the hardware is working....or, you just need to blank it out in Nistune. Do not persist with the stock ECU. You will just have problems. Gte it Nistuned. Start from there. DO YOU HAVE A BOOST SENSOR? The ECU's boost sensor that it. It is connected to the loom at the rear of the coil cover. Usually rides on the firewall on an R34, but is usually bolted down to a bracket along with all the other crap at the back of the coil cover when a Neo is dropped into another car. If you do not have it, the ECU will shit the bed. So, do you have one?
